How easy is it to transfer to your next cruise?? ** There is no maxmum that can be applied to your OBC from the Royal visa Program, hwever the certificates issued by BOA are only good for a certain time period after issue and once redemed to RCCL and the OBC is applied to your account there is no going back and you cant take it with you after the cruise. It becomes a use it or lose it affair. My experience has been to call BOA a few months ahead and have them send the certs. Then fill out te certs and send them to RCCL with all the cruise info (ie. res #, Date of saling, ship) I have never had a problem and beleive that using the points for OBC is the best use. Yes you can use them for free cruises with some massive points, but watching for deals negates saving points for a free cruise.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
